French soldiers removing wine for safe keeping, WW1

French soldiers removing wine from cellars in Amiens for safe keeping on the British Western Front during World War One. Date: circa 1916

EDITORS COMMENTS
Amidst the chaos and destruction of the Western Front during World War One, French soldiers take a moment to preserve a piece of their country's rich cultural heritage. In this evocative photograph, taken circa 1916, soldiers are seen carefully removing crates of wine from the cellars of Amiens for safe keeping. The wooden crates are carefully balanced on the back of a lorry, with the soldiers' determined expressions and the cobblestone streets of Amiens providing a stark contrast to the more familiar images of battle and destruction. The importance of wine to the people of France, particularly in the region of Champagne and the Picardy area around Amiens, cannot be overstated. Wine was not only a source of pride and identity for the French people, but also an essential part of their daily diet. With the German advance threatening to reach the French capital, the Allied forces recognized the importance of preserving the country's wine reserves. The soldiers, dressed in their uniforms and armed with shovels and crates, work diligently to transport the precious cargo to safer locations. The lorries, with their distinctive British insignia, stand ready to transport the wine to the rear lines, where it would be stored in secure cellars until the war's end. This photograph offers a rare glimpse into the human side of the war, highlighting the resilience and resourcefulness of the soldiers in the face of adversity. It also serves as a reminder of the profound impact of the conflict on European culture and history.
